1 The LORD spoke again to Moses, saying,

2 “Speak to the children of Israel and say to them, ‘The appointed times (established feasts) of the LORD which you shall proclaim as holy convocations—My appointed times are these:

3 ‘For six days work may be done, but the seventh day is the Sabbath of complete rest, a holy convocation (calling together). You shall not do any work [on that day]; it is the Sabbath of the LORD wherever you may be.

4 ‘These are the appointed times of the LORD, holy convocations which you shall proclaim at their appointed times:

5 The LORD’S Passover is on the fourteenth day of the first month at twilight.

6 The Feast of Unleavened Bread to the LORD is on the fifteenth day of the same month; for seven days you shall eat unleavened bread.

7 On the first day you shall have a holy convocation (calling together); you shall not do any laborious work [on that day].

8 But you shall present an offering by fire to the LORD for seven days; on the seventh day there shall be a holy convocation; you shall not do any laborious work [on that day].’”

Leviticus 23:1-8, Amplified Bible. Copyright © 2015 by The Lockman Foundation.
